Road cycling around San Giorgio Morgeto offers diverse terrain within the Aspromonte National Park, ranging from the plains of Gioia Tauro to the hills and mountains of Aspromonte. The region features varied elevation, providing routes with different gradients suitable for various fitness levels. Cyclists can encounter centuries-old beech woods and enjoy views encompassing the Calabrian coast and the Messina Strait.

There are over 100 road cycling routes around San Giorgio Morgeto, offering a wide range of options for different fitness levels and preferences. This includes 13 easy routes, 47 moderate routes, and 45 difficult routes.
The terrain around San Giorgio Morgeto is highly diverse, ranging from the plains of Gioia Tauro to the hills and mountains of Aspromonte National Park. You can find routes with varied gradients, from gentle rides through agricultural areas to challenging climbs with significant elevation gains.
The region generally offers good cycling conditions for much of the year. Spring and autumn provide pleasant temperatures, while summer can be warm, especially in the plains. Higher elevation routes in the Aspromonte National Park may offer cooler temperatures during the hotter months.
Yes, there are several easier routes. For example, the San Martino di Taurianova from Polistena – loop tour is an easy 35.6 km trail through the plains of Gioia Tauro, typically completed in about 1 hour 32 minutes.
Experienced riders seeking a challenge can explore routes like From Polistena to Santa Cristina d'Aspromonte in the Aspromonte National Park, an 84.3 km path with over 1,500 meters of elevation gain. Another demanding option is the Passo del Mercante – Gerace Historic Village loop from Polistena, which covers 96.4 km with nearly 2,000 meters of climbing.
Many routes offer breathtaking panoramas of the Calabrian coast, the Messina Strait, and even the distant Aeolian Islands. You can also encounter natural spectacles like the Galasia Waterfall in Aspromonte National Park, or traverse the historic Passo della Limina, known for its long descent through beech woods.
Yes, the region is rich in history. You can find routes that pass by the ruins of the Norman-Swabian San Giorgio Morgeto Castle, offering dominant views. The medieval village of San Giorgio Morgeto itself has a charming historic center with ancient churches and monuments.
Yes, many routes are designed as loops, allowing you to start and end in the same location. An example is the Palmi and Gioia Tauro loop, a moderate 66.2 km ride offering scenic coastal views.
